Isolating Oxidized Steel Within Melanesian Flora

Aperture settings between f/2.8 and f/4.0 isolate foreground subjects. This optical isolation is necessary when documenting Marston Matting sections measuring 10 feet by 15 inches. Initially, the approach relied on wide-angle landscape shots to capture the scale of abandoned airfields. This was discarded because the rusted steel blended too seamlessly into the undergrowth. Instead, the decision shifted to using an 85mm macro lens to isolate the jagged edges of the steel against the soft focus of the surrounding flora.

Recognizing subtle environmental changes requires a trained eye. Bomb craters find new utility as agricultural ponds. Airstrip matting serves as property boundaries. The visual contrast between the natural beauty of Melanesian landscapes and the harsh, rusting geometry of unexploded ordnance creates narrative tension. Depth of field and natural lighting emphasize the integration of military remnants into civilian life while keeping these historical artifacts distinct.

Distinguishing Historical Steel from Modern Fencing

Failure to differentiate between oxidized Marston Matting and standard agricultural fencing in Melanesian topsoil compromises the historical integrity of the visual record. Photographers must verify the origin of the materials before framing the shot.

The 85mm lens compresses the background, bringing the dense jungle canopy closer to the rusted subject. This compression highlights the ongoing battle between industrial decay and organic growth. The rust itself becomes a subject, its textured, flaking surface contrasting sharply with the smooth, vibrant leaves of the encroaching vines. Capturing this texture requires precise focus and an understanding of how tropical light filters through the canopy.

Establishing Secure Perimeters Around Unexploded Ordnance

Documenting contaminated zones demands absolute adherence to established safe lanes. Establishing a shooting perimeter meant coordinating with local demining teams to map out a strict safe lane, ensuring tripod legs never breached uncleared topsoil. These safe lanes are restricted to 3 to 5 meters in width. The photographer's role remains strictly observational, documenting the clearance process without ever interfering with or handling the remnants.

The tripod footprint is kept within a 24-inch radius of verified cleared ground. Working alongside certified clearance personnel ensures that the documentation process does not endanger the crew or the community. However, these clearance protocols apply strictly to officially surveyed UXO zones and cannot guarantee safety in undocumented secondary jungle growth where seasonal flooding shifts buried ordnance.

The decision to photograph in these undocumented areas carries catastrophic risk — a single misstep yields catastrophic consequences. The margin for error is nonexistent. Every movement must be calculated, every step verified. The tension of working in these environments translates into the final images, imbuing them with a sense of underlying danger despite the outward tranquility of the landscape.

UXO Zone Photography Protocol

  • Verify safe lane boundaries with local clearance personnel before unpacking gear.
  • Equip tripod legs with wide-base feet to prevent accidental soil penetration.
  • Map out a 24-inch maximum movement radius for the camera operator.

Field observations showed that introducing a camera too early disrupted the natural rhythm of a resettled community. Determining the right moment to introduce the camera involved participating in daily agricultural routines without equipment, allowing the community to dictate the pace of the visual documentation. This ethical framework requires investing time to understand the community's current rebuilding efforts rather than solely focusing on their past trauma.

In this work, initial integration periods lasted 3 to 4 days before equipment was introduced. Subsequent interviews spanned 45 to 90 minutes to establish informed consent. Collaborating with subjects ensures their dignity is preserved in the final images. This approach supports ethical documentation in post-conflict zones.

Metering the Canopy: A Solomon Islands Still Life

Deep within a Solomon Islands garden, the humid air hangs heavy over the broad, vibrant green leaves of a taro plant. Resting against the base of the stalk sits a heavily oxidized WWII artillery shell, its rusted iron casing flaking into the damp, dark soil. The farmer moves quietly in the background, tending to the roots, entirely accustomed to the lethal geometry sharing space with the evening meal.

Setting up the stabilized tripod requires deliberate, slow movements to avoid disturbing the delicate root system or breaching the verified safe zone. Metering the scene required spot-metering the highlights on the taro leaves and the deep shadows of the oxidized mortar casing, ultimately underexposing slightly to retain the rich greens of the canopy light. The exposure times range from 1/15 to 1/30 of a second, capturing the absolute stillness of the humid air.

Adjusting Exposure for Regional Canopy Density

This metering technique is calibrated for the dense canopy light of the Solomon Islands and will overexpose subjects in sparse, arid post-conflict zones.
